Need help on Xperia Z Tablet (SGP311U1/B)

Hello,

Xperia Z Tablet (SGP311U1/B) brought in the US last year failed to update to KitKat in Bangalore, India. Contacted most of the regional service centers in Bangalore and none of them are willing to provide support to a product brought in the US. It is very disappointing and frustrating to undergo this kind of an experience with a brand like Sony, especially when all electronic products at home are from the same manufacturer. Request your help in bringing back the tablet to its working condition.

What happened?

1) Received a notification to update the tablet to KitKat

2) Connected to PC via Sony PC Companion

Error: An error has occurred and the device software update was cancelled. Don't worry, click Retry and follow the instructions to restart the update process. If you still encounter problems after a retry click Close and follow instructions how to contact Sony Mobile.

You need to perform a system repair which will factory reset your phone

Switch off your tablet and unplug from Pc (Hold volume up and power for around 10 seconds)

Start PC Companion and select Support zone then Update my phone/tablet then in Blue Repair my phone/tablet and follow the onscreen instructions - When prompted connect your tablet still switched off holding volume down or back button - This should start the repair or reformat process

If you are using Windows 8/8.1 or a 64bit operating system then adjust the settings for PC Companion and run in compatibility mode and chose Windows 7 or XP
